Tech Guides, Tech News, Gadgets

Evolve Insider: Electric Riders Around The World


Riders From Around The World is back! Take a trip around the world on this Insider Episode and check out what Evolve Riders are up to all over the globe.


Leave A Reply

Your email address will not be published.